Why Cream Cheese Melting Often Goes Wrong (and How to Fix It)

Understanding the Context

Cream cheese is beloved for its smooth texture and mild flavor, but it’s notoriously tricky to melt smoothly. Its high fat and casein content make it prone to curdling, skin formation, and lumpiness—especially when overheated or mixed incorrectly. Traditional methods like microwave heating often lead to uneven results, while stovetop attempts risk burning or clumping.

Step 2: Warm Gently with Moisture
Instead of dry heat, introduce moisture to keep the cheese luxuriously smooth. Pour in just a tablespoon or two of warm milk, heavy cream, or whole milk—the key is warmth, not dilution. Place the bowl in a larger pan filled with in muito caliente (but not boiling) water. Think of it as a gentle steam bath:

  • Maintain a steady, warm temperature (not above 140°F / 60°C)
    - Stir continuously with a personal whisk or silicone spatula
    - Wait 8–12 minutes, checking for a velvety, glossy consistency

Step 3: Stop at Sheen, Remove from Heat
Once smooth and silky, remove immediately. The gentle warmth melts the fat uniformly without breaking the proteins—no curdling, no skin. If you’re adding other ingredients like garlic, herbs, or flavorings, fold them in now for a perfectly integrated sauce or dip.
